The budding pilots can thank Brown, Root and Marshall Aerospace (BRAMA), the civilian engineering contractor based at RAF Valley. It is expanding a private pilots' licence sponsorship scheme linked to the island's three ATC ATC Air Traffic Control ATC Average Total Cost ATC Certified Athletic Trainer ATC At the Center (Hartford, Maine retreat center) ATC Applied Technology Council ATC All Things Considered squadrons. Originally the firm, working alongside Mona Flying Club, backed one trainee but now each squadron can nominate. This year's lucky trio are Jonathan French,15,of 2474 (Cefni) Squadron, Lawrence Williams of 1465 (Menai Bridge) Squadron and Jack Walsh of 2378 (Holyhead) Squadron,both 16-years-old. The names `` were announced by Mervyn Clackett,BRAMA contracts manager when he presented a certificate of wings to last year's sponsorship recipient 18-year-old Richard Hughes, of Talwrn, near Llangefni,during the Cefni squadron's annual dinner Richard, who is hoping to become a search and rescue helicopter pilot with the RAF, said: ``The BRAMA scholarship has helped me fulfil my dream of getting a pilots' licence.'' The squadron's best female cadet award went to Rebecca Gray,15,of Llanddaniel, while Daniel Evans, also 15,of Malltraeth, scooped the awards for both best male cadet and the Sqn. Ldr.Parry -Jones Shield for best overall cadet. |
